Ignition Repair

It can be a huge trouble when the car key gets stuck in the ignition. It is important to get it fixed as quickly as you can to return to the road. You might be tempted take it to the dealership, but this can be costly. Locksmiths are able to fix your car key locksmith near me's ignition at a lower cost than you would pay at the dealership. It is also possible to invalidate your warranty if you cause damage to the car when trying to remove the key.

The ignition cylinder can be damaged by normal wear and tear. Some people make use of oversized keys that put additional pressure on the locking mechanism.

If your ignition cylinder is having trouble turning your key, you should call a locksmith for cars near me right away. The expert will be able to identify the issue and provide an immediate practical solution.

The ignition switch does not switch on. This can be caused by a number of factors, such as worn-out tumblers in the cylinder lock or damaged or broken ignition wiring. A skilled locksmith for cars can examine the entire ignition system to find out what's wrong.

If the ignition switch is malfunctioning the locksmith can replace it on the spot. The procedure is usually simple and doesn't require the steering wheel to be removed. Lockouts

A lockout is among the most frustrating problems you'll ever encounter. It's also a risk especially if there are elderly or children in the. There are many methods to gain access to your car if you're locked out. You can utilize a spare key, or ask for help from a neighbor, but these methods require some skill and time. It is also essential to keep a spare key in a safe location so that you can get into your vehicle if you forget your keys or get locked out again.

If you're locked out of your car, the first thing to do is remain calm and find an opening method to the door. Call 911 immediately if you suspect there is an infant or elderly passenger in your vehicle. Emergency services can save lives and lower the risk that someone will be injured or killed. After that, call an emergency service provider on the road or locksmith. Some service providers such as AAA provide free lockouts to their members, but it may take some time for them to show up. You can also use a pay on demand app, like HONK which connects you to the nearest service provider. Unlike traditional tow truck services, HONK has transparent up-front pricing and does not charge per mile or hour.

Certain automakers also have apps that let you unlock your vehicle from the driver's mobile. If you are a subscriber to OnStar with General Motors for example, you might be able to unlock your car using the app. BMW and Hyundai also have apps that work with their vehicles.

Another option is to use a wedge or long-reach tool to create gaps between the frame and window. Then, you can use an instrument like a wire hanger or dedicated car unlocking device to manipulate the lock mechanism to unlock the door.
